#eu{
	postition:relative;
	top:0px;
	width:407px;
	float:left;	
}
#border{
	postition:relative;
	top:0px;
	width:197px;
	height:60px;
	float:right;
}
#topmenu{
	postition:absolute;
	top:0px;
	left:0px;
	width:604px;
	height:33px;
	float:right;	
}
#logo{
	postition:absolute;
	top:0px;
	left:0px;
	width:176px;
	height:53px;
	float:left;
}
#topnavigation{
	postition:absolute;
	top:0px;
	left:0px;
	width:604px;
	height:20px;
	float:right;
}

#container {
height: 563px;
width: 780px;
z-index: 2;
position:absolute;
text-align: left;
left: 50%;
margin-left: -390px;
top:0px;
}

#menudiv {
height: 53px;
left: 176px;
position: absolute;
top: 0px;
width: 604px;
z-index: 1;
}

#logodiv {
height: 53px;
left: 0px;
position: absolute;
top: 0px;
width: 176px;
z-index: 1;
}

#submenudiv {
background-color:#E7E7EF;
height: 450px;
left: 0px;
position: absolute;
top: 53px;
width: 176px;
z-index: 1;
}

#maindiv {
height: 450px;
left: 176px;
position: absolute;
top: 53px;
width: 604px;
z-index: 1;
}

#submaindiv {
height: 61px;
left: 176px;
position: absolute;
top: 503px;
width: 605px;
z-index: 1;
}

#subbottomdiv {
height: 61px;
left: 0px;
position: absolute;
top: 503px;
width: 176px;
z-index: 1;
}

A{
	color:#804000;
}

A.internal-link{
	color:#804000;
}
A.internal-link-pop{
	color:#000080;
}
A.lexikon-link{
	color:#008000;
}
A.links-link{
	color:#FF8000;
}
A.external-link{
	color:#FF0000;
}
li.no-style{
	font-size:0.9em;
}
body{
	/*margin-top:10px;*/
	/*margin-left:0px;*/
	/*margin-right:0px;*/
font-family:Arial;

}
p{
	font-size:0.9em;
}
p.bodytext-imp{
	font-size:0.7em;
}
.tx-indexedsearch{
	margin:7px;
	width:570px;
}
TD.tx-indexedsearch-info{
	font-size:0.7em;
}
TD.tx-indexedsearch-descr{
	font-size:0.8em;
}
H2{
	font-size:1.0em;
}

.csi-textpic{
	/*border:1px solid red;*/
	/*width:550px;*/
	width:98%;
	margin-left:6px;
}
.ul-sub-main{
	margin:7px;
	padding:0px;
	font-size:0.7em;
	font-family:Comic Sans MS;
}
.li-sub-main{
	margin:7px;
	padding:0px;
	list-style-type: none;
	line-height:1.2em;
}
.ul-sub-sub{
	margin:7px;
	padding:0px;
}
.li-sub-sub{
	margin:7px;

	padding:0px;
	list-style-type: none;
	line-height:1em;
}
li-sub-valid{
	margin:0px;
	padding:0px;
}
h1.mainheadline{
	font-family:Comic Sans MS;
	font-size:30px;
	color:white;
}
h2.mainheadline{
	font-family:Comic Sans MS;
	font-size:18px;
	font-weight:normal;
	color:white;
}
h3.small_headline{
	font-family:Comic Sans MS;
	font-weight:normal;
	font-size:16px;
	margin-left:6px;
	margin-top:6px;
	text-align:left;
}
A.menuitem-normal{
	text-decoration:none;
	color:black;
}
A.submenuitem-normal{
	text-decoration:none;
	color:black;
}
A.menuitem-act{
	text-decoration:none;
	color:black;
	font-weight:bold;
}
A.submenuitem-act{
	text-decoration:none;
	color:black;
	font-weight:bold;
}
A.borderlink{
	font-size:12px;
	font-family:Arial;
	text-decoration:none;
	color:#5C5C5C;
}

A.borderlinkbold{
	font-size:12px;
	font-family:Arial;
	font-weight:bold;
	text-decoration:none;
	color:#5C5C5C;
}